Calcolatore Estrazione Fogli di Calcolo SICRA
Risultati del Calcolo
Guida Completa: Come Estrarre Fogli di Calcolo dal Programma SICRA
Il sistema SICRA (Sistema Informativo Contabile della Ragioneria) rappresenta lo strumento fondamentale per la gestione contabile e finanziaria delle pubbliche amministrazioni italiane. L’estrazione dei fogli di calcolo da questo sistema è un’operazione critica che richiede precisione e conoscenza delle procedure specifiche.
1. Comprendere la Struttura di SICRA
Prima di procedere con l’estrazione, è essenziale comprendere l’architettura del sistema:
- Modulo Contabile: Gestisce le scritture contabili e i bilanci
- Modulo Patrimoniale: Amministra i beni e le risorse dell’ente
- Modulo Inventario: Catalogazione e gestione dei beni mobili e immobili
- Modulo Bilancio: Elaborazione e controllo dei documenti di bilancio
2. Procedure di Estrazione Standard
Esistono tre metodi principali per estrarre i dati da SICRA:
- Esportazione Diretta: Utilizzo delle funzioni native del sistema (File → Esporta)
- Query SQL: Per utenti avanzati con accesso al database sottostante
- API Dedicate: Per integrazioni con altri sistemi (richiede autorizzazioni specifiche)
Attenzione: L’estrazione di dati sensibili deve essere autorizzata dal Responsabile del Trattamento dei Dati secondo il Regolamento GDPR.
3. Formati di Esportazione Supportati
| Formato | Estensione | Vantaggi | Svantaggi | Dimensione Media |
|---|---|---|---|---|
| Excel (XLSX) | .xlsx | Formattazione preservata, formule attive | Dimensione maggiore, compatibilità limitata | 1.2-1.5x dimensione originale |
| CSV | .csv | Compatibilità universale, dimensione ridotta | Nessuna formattazione, dati grezzi | 0.3-0.5x dimensione originale |
| Formattazione fissa, adatto per archiviazione | Non modificabile, dimensione variabile | 0.8-1.2x dimensione originale | ||
| XML | .xml | Struttura dati preservata, interoperabilità | Complessità di lettura, dimensione media | 0.6-0.9x dimensione originale |
4. Passaggi Dettagliati per l’Esportazione
Seguire questa procedura standardizzata per garantire un’estrazione corretta:
- Accesso al Sistema:
- Autenticarsi con credenziali amministrative
- Verificare i permessi di esportazione (Modulo → Gestione Utenti)
- Selezione dei Dati:
- Navigare al modulo desiderato (es. Contabile → Scritture)
- Applicare filtri temporali (anno fiscale, periodo)
- Selezionare i campi specifici da esportare
- Configurazione Esportazione:
- Scegliere il formato di output (consigliato XLSX per dati complessi)
- Impostare eventuali opzioni di formattazione
- Definire il percorso di salvataggio (locale o server)
- Esecuzione e Verifica:
- Avviare il processo di esportazione
- Monitorare la barra di avanzamento
- Verificare l’integrità del file estratto
5. Ottimizzazione delle Prestazioni
Per estrazioni di grandi dimensioni (oltre 10.000 record), adottare queste strategie:
- Orari Non di Picco: Eseguire le operazioni fuori dagli orari di lavoro (20:00-06:00)
- Lotti: Suddividere l’estrazione in lotti da 5.000-8.000 record
- Indici: Assicurarsi che il database abbia indici ottimizzati per le query
- Hardware: Utilizzare workstation con almeno 16GB RAM e SSD
| Parametro | Valore Minimo | Valore Consigliato | Valore Ottimale |
|---|---|---|---|
| RAM | 8GB | 16GB | 32GB+ |
| CPU | Dual Core | Quad Core | Hexa Core+ |
| Spazio Disco | 50GB | 250GB SSD | 500GB+ NVMe |
| Larghezza Banda | 10 Mbps | 100 Mbps | 1 Gbps |
6. Gestione degli Errori Comuni
Durante il processo di estrazione, possono verificarsi i seguenti errori:
- Timeout: Aumentare il limite di timeout nel file di configurazione (sicra.config → export_timeout)
- Permessi: Verificare i diritti di accesso alla cartella di destinazione (chmod 755)
- Formato Non Supportato: Aggiornare i driver ODBC per l’esportazione in formati specifici
- Dati Corrotti: Eseguire un controllo di integrità con lo strumento di validazione integrato
7. Sicurezza e Conformità
L’estrazione dei dati da SICRA deve rispettare rigorosi standard di sicurezza:
- Tutti i file estratti devono essere crittografati con standard AES-256
- I log delle operazioni devono essere conservati per 5 anni (D.Lgs. 196/2003)
- L’accesso ai dati sensibili richiede autenticazione a due fattori
- Le esportazioni devono essere approvate dal Responsabile della Conservazione
Per approfondimenti sulle normative vigenti, consultare il sito dell’Agenzia per l’Italia Digitale e le linee guida della Funzione Pubblica.
8. Automazione dei Processi
Per enti con esigenze ricorrenti, è possibile implementare soluzioni di automazione:
- Script Python: Utilizzando le librerie
pyodbceopenpyxl - Macro VBA: Per integrazione diretta con Microsoft Excel
- Servizi Windows: Pianificazione automatica tramite Task Scheduler
- API REST: Per integrazione con altri sistemi gestionali
Esempio di script Python base per estrazione automatizzata:
import pyodbc
import pandas as pd
# Connessione al database SICRA
conn = pyodbc.connect(
"DRIVER={ODBC Driver 17 for SQL Server};"
"SERVER=sicra-server;"
"DATABASE=SICRA_DB;"
"UID=utente;"
"PWD=password"
)
# Query di estrazione
query = """
SELECT * FROM ScrittureContabili
WHERE Anno = 2023
AND Mese BETWEEN 1 AND 6
"""
# Esportazione in Excel
df = pd.read_sql(query, conn)
df.to_excel("estrazione_sicra_2023H1.xlsx", index=False)
# Chiusura connessione
conn.close()
9. Best Practice per la Conservazione
I dati estratti devono essere conservati secondo precise metodologie:
- Formati: Preferire formati aperti (CSV, XML) per la conservazione a lungo termine
- Metadati: Includere sempre data/ora estrazione, operatore, versione SICRA
- Backup: Mantenere 3 copie in luoghi fisici diversi (regola 3-2-1)
- Verifica: Eseguire controlli di integrità trimestrali con checksum MD5
10. Aggiornamenti e Manutenzione
Il sistema SICRA viene aggiornato periodicamente con nuove funzionalità:
- Versione 8.0: Introduzione dell’esportazione in formato JSON
- Versione 7.5: Ottimizzazione delle query per database superiori a 1TB
- Versione 7.0: Supporto nativo per la crittografia end-to-end
Si consiglia di:
- Verificare mensilmente la disponibilità di aggiornamenti
- Testare le nuove funzionalità in ambiente di staging
- Partecipare ai webinar formativi organizzati dal Ministero dell’Economia e delle Finanze
Importante: Le procedure descritte possono variare in base alla specifica configurazione del sistema SICRA implementata dal tuo ente. Consulta sempre il manuale tecnico specifico o il servizio di assistenza dedicato.